Greece - Export of Transformers Electric Having a Power Handling Capacity of 500 kVA and more

Since 2014, Greece Export of Transformers Electric Having a Power Handling Capacity of 500 kVA and more rose 12.5% year on year. At $60,732.64 in 2019, the country was ranked number 80 among other countries in Export of Transformers Electric Having a Power Handling Capacity of 500 kVA and more. Greece is overtaken by Bosnia and Herzegovina, which was ranked number 79 at $72,723.01 and is followed by Republic of the Congo at $59,258.61. Germany lead the ranking with $228,822,474.26 in 2019, that is a fall of 1.1% versus 2018. China, Italy and Spain resp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Antigua and Barbuda recorded the best 5 years average growth at +238.6% per year, while Uganda was the worst growing country at -81.4% per year.
